Understanding Crypto Betting: Your Gateway to World Cup Engagement (What It Is, How It Works, and Why Fans Are Betting On It)
Crypto betting, in simple terms, is the act of placing wagers on various events, including major sporting tournaments like the World Cup, using cryptocurrencies instead of traditional fiat money. This innovative approach leverages blockchain technology, offering several distinct advantages. Primarily, it provides enhanced transparency, as transactions are recorded on a decentralized ledger, and often boasts lower transaction fees compared to conventional online betting platforms. Furthermore, it affords users a greater degree of anonymity and global accessibility, bypassing some of the geographical restrictions and bureaucratic hurdles associated with traditional financial systems. Imagine being able to bet on your favorite team from virtually anywhere, at any time, with funds that are entirely under your control and verifiable on a public blockchain. This fundamental shift in how we engage with betting is what makes crypto betting a fascinating and increasingly popular option.
The operational mechanics of crypto betting are surprisingly straightforward, often mirroring traditional online betting with a crucial difference in the payment gateway. Users typically register on a crypto-betting platform, deposit cryptocurrency (such as Bitcoin, Ethereum, or various altcoins) into their account, and then proceed to place bets on desired outcomes. Winnings, if any, are paid out directly in cryptocurrency, which can then be held, traded, or converted back to fiat currency.
